About Trial Library
Trial Library is an AI-native enrollment and care navigation platform that accelerates access to precision medicine. In collaboration with biopharmaceutical manufacturers, payers, and health systems, Trial Library enables the delivery of clinical trials as a standard care option - improving patient access, advancing oncology outcomes, and reducing the total cost of care.
Backed by leading healthcare venture capital firms, Trial Library’s platform is currently deployed in 840+ clinics and 3,000+ providers nationwide.
Reporting into the Director of Provider Partnerships, the Account Executive owns new business growth for Trial Library's provider network. You will source, pitch, and close new partnerships with community providers, community health systems, and research-capable oncology clinics — then nurture and expand those relationships once they're live. This is a new-business role, and most of your pipeline will come from channels you build yourself.
Community oncology practices treat the majority of cancer patients in the United States, but most have no practical path to offering clinical trials to their patients. Trial Library exists to close that gap. Our platform makes trial enrollment navigable for community sites, and every partnership you sign expands the number of patients who can access precision medicine close to home.
